Tuesday Update

So many are asking the same question:

How do we give and how will you get help?

CrossWorld has a crisis relief fund at www.crossworld.org or if you prefer to know funds go to directly to us they can be sent to: David Schmid earthquake relief at CrossWorld, 10000 N. Oak Trafficway, Kansas City MO 64155.

We will be involved in the disbursement of the CrossWorld crisis relief funds too. CW has set up crisis relief funds before for Tropical storm Jeanne and Hurricane Hannah and drought conditions and they have been effective in being used as intended.

Banks are not working. CW is sending in first responders who will arrive with liquid – if you know what I mean. So either way it will get to us. So far people here are getting food and water.

Our part of the city though damaged is getting some water which is so helpful. No showers but at least a little for hygiene. An important need is making a water filtration system for immediate drinking water. Roger See is arriving on Thursday and he will be bringing supplies to get that set up.

My gallon of Clorox is getting very low and so I’m asking God to keep it filled. I know He can!It is hard to get news out every day. Our days are just so full.

Pray for safe arrival of trucks and aid missions as without a military escort they are in great danger.

David is going out later today to pick up a first responder and supplies that are coming in on MFI. I have prayed that the two trucks going out and back will be “invisible”.

A large dump truck is bring supplies from Judy and Manis and from the Robinsons. It is heavily loaded and coming over rough roads. Please pray for this truck, its drivers and its load to safely arrive with God's protection.

God is giving daily strength and I am so thankful. We receive so much encouragement from around the world. It is amazing.
